Transaction f3e101bc248be3e36b53944a396cdab264af3b7ae503d33648ea4cc3c4238264
1 Input
1 Output
-
f3e101bc248be3e36b53944a396cdab264af3b7ae503d33648ea4cc3c4238264:0
- value
- 716262
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b614b795b3da36f2b409b03a421052898973a712 OP_EQUAL
- address
- 3JHmiudNfFpiTUQr1crSAGrUR8VaB4VSDh